What type of skill is hand-eye coordination?

Eye-hand coordination is a complex cognitive ability, as it calls for us to unite our visual and motor skills, allowing for the hand to be guided by the visual stimulation our eyes receive.

What kind of toys help with hand-eye coordination? Balls. Whether they’re bounced, rolled, caught, or thrown, balls encourage gross motor skills, hand–eye coordination, and dexterity. Shape-sorting toys. Pegboard puzzles, nesting cups or blocks, and buckets with holes for different shaped blocks challenge hand-eye coordination and problem-solving skills.

What is hand eye coordination important for? Hand-eye coordination helps us effectively and efficiently use our hands based on what we see. It involves a three-step process: Eyes – Identify details relevant to the task. Brain – Process what the eyes see and send instructions to the body. Hands – Follow the brain’s instructions.

How can I improve my hand-eye coordination at home?

All exercise is good for your brain, and the following may be especially helpful for eye-hand coordination.

  1. Racquet sports. In tennis, racquetball, or pickleball, your eyes watch the ball, and your brain instructs your body to meet up with it.

Do athletes have better hand-eye coordination?

Eye-hand coordination, the synchronization between the visual and motor systems, is critical in high-speed sport movements but is highly variable among athletes. … “This is the first time we were able to correlate visual performance on a hand-eye, visual reaction time test with on-field performance,” Dr. Kirschen says.

Why is hand and eye coordination important for kids?

Hand-eye coordination is a crucial ability that lies at the core of many academic, sports, and life skills. It is a vital skill for school success because it allows children to use their vision and muscles to perform tasks such as writing, drawing, tying shoelaces, or catching a ball.

What is hand-eye coordination in badminton?

Eye–hand coordination is a crucial visual motor function that facilitates goal-directed use of the arm, hand, and fingers to produce controlled, accurate, and rapid movements, especially during sporting activities such as badminton.
